Skinny Trees

April 3, 2009
Arrived in Inuvik, Northwest Territories, Canada where the trees are skinny, the fog is frozen, and the MacKenzie River is a huge ice road. I'm back in the arctic, and back at this blog for a couple of weeks. I'm here for my adviser's frozen lake sediment coring project. We're off now into sunny -20 degree C weather on snowmobiles with a tobaggon in tow, along the river to "Little Skidoo Lake." I'll be back...
